The Institute for Precision Medicine hosts a monthly speaker series to highlight advances in Precision Medicine research and in Personalized Care – not only at Pitt/UPMC but across the United States.

The third IPM speaker for the Fall 2022 semester will be given by Jeanette McCarthy MPH, PhD, on November 16th at 4:00pm via Zoom. Dr McCarthy is the Founder of Precision Medicine Advisors, a group which focusses on improving genomic literacy and VP of Precision Medicine at Fabric Genomics. She is also Adjunct Associate Professor of Medicine at the University of California San Francisco and Duke University where she is part of the Center for Personalized and Precision Medicine. Dr McCarthy is a UC Berkeley trained genetic epidemiologist and spent the early part of her career in industry at Millennium Pharmaceuticals before transitioning to academia. Her previous research focused on the genetic underpinnings of complex diseases. Over the past decade, she has become a leading educator in the field of genomic and precision medicine and an advisor to the genetic testing industry.

In her presentation entitled ‘A Practical Approach to Precision Medicine Education’, Dr McCarthy will share her experience over the past decade as a precision medicine leader and educator. She will present data on utilization of precision medicine and address some of the health care skepticism about genetic testing. Dr McCarthy will share a pragmatic genetics education approach for healthcare providers that aims to improve genomic literacy and instill practical skills for integrating genetic testing into patient care.
